1
0
mirror of https://github.com/Pomax/BezierInfo-2.git synced 2025-02-24 17:42:43 +01:00
BezierInfo-2/lib/p-loader.js
2016-01-09 18:39:09 -08:00

18 lines
419 B
JavaScript

var blockLoader = require("block-loader");
var options = {
start: "<p>",
end: "</p>",
/**
* JSX curly brace replacement.
*/
process: function fixPreBlocks(p) {
var replaced = p.replace(options.start,'').replace(options.end,'');
if(replaced.indexOf("\\[")>-1) return p;
return options.start + replaced.replace(/([{}])/g,"{'$1'}") + options.end;
}
};
module.exports = blockLoader(options);